After no-compute-fanout-to-scheduler, host_ip was stored in the table
of compute_nodes. Host ip address should be considered as the hypervisor
attribute similar to the hypervisor_type, hypervisor_version etc, and
now those attributes such as hypervisor_type, hypervisor_version etc
are all listed as the hypervisor attribute when calling "nova
hypervisor-show host", so we can also set "host_ip" as a new attribute
output for this command.
DocImpact
1) Only administrators can view hypervisor detail in nova.
2) It can help improve debug capabilities for nova. For example, if
admin using SimpleCIDRAffinityFilter, then after VM is deployed, admin
can check if the VM was deployed successfully to the desired host by
checking ip address of the host via "nova hypervisor-show host".
3) Add host_ip to the output for "nova hypervisor-show"
Implement bp hypervisor-show-ip
